About The Position

The University of Iowa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ology is seeking a patient centered allied health professional desiring a clearly defined medical career path. A Medical Scribe (Clerk Typist III) in Obstetrics and Gynecology division of Maternal Fetal Medicine will act as an assistant to the physician; performing documentation in Epic, gathering information for the patient's visit, and partnering with the physician to deliver efficient patient care. The Scribe will perform complex typing or word processing assignments on a regular and recurring basis, such as typing physician notes and templates requiring specialized terminology, and perform related clerical work as required. Duties involve the use of personal computers, computer terminals, and a variety of software some of which may be discipline specific. The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ology provides consultation, comprehensive treatment planning and a broad range of services for patients with normal and high-risk pregnancies and for gynecology, including oncology and reproductive endocrinology. Our comprehensive medical, surgical, and nursing services span the full spectrum of all obstetric and gynecologic patients at University of Iowa Hospitals & Clinics. In addition to patient care, the department is noted for its strong educational programs for sonography students, medical students, residents, fellows, and practicing physicians. Basic and clinical research in reproductive medicine is an important departmental activity.
